Gainesville 69, Dolphins 36 The Canes jumped out to a 7-0 lead in the opening minute and never looked back as they cruised past the Dolphins in an opening round game Dec. 27. Gainesville (8-2) scored 20 points off of their 20 offensive rebounds (GBHS had only six offensive boards), while scoring 10 off of Dolphin turnovers. Conversely, the Dolphins had six second chance points and only three points off of Gainesville turnovers. Shreve and Derek Orban both had six points for the Dolphins, while Cann, Matt Patrick and Dustin Clements had four each, Eric Mims and Marcus Smith three each and Hibberts, Stuart Franklin and Dane Baker had two each. Hibberts also had six rebounds in the loss, while Cann had five. Harpeth (Tenn.) 70, Dolphins 55 The Indians (10-7) led 8-2 after one quarter and led by 15 (21-6) at the half, as the Dolphins shot the ball only seven times in the first two quarters. Gulf Breeze shot a respectable 48 percent from the field (20-for-42), but Harpeth made 58 percent of its shots (25- for-43). Hibberts led Gulf Breeze with 10 points, six rebounds and four steals, while Cann had seven points, five rebounds and five steals. Catellier had seven points and three steals, while Mims had six points. Patrick and White both had five points. Shreve and Smith both had four points in the loss, while Orban had three and Dustin Clements and Franklin two each. Gulf Breeze hosts Navarre on Friday and Pine Forest on Tuesday. |
